Land Market Insights and Pricing in Sabine County, Texas

On average, land listings in Sabine County, TX have a lot size of 39 acres and are priced around $367,437. The median price per acre in Sabine County, TX is $7,907.

About Sabine County, TX
Sabine County, Texas, offers a compelling blend of natural beauty and rural charm for land buyers. Spanning 577 square miles, the county boasts diverse landscapes, including the expansive Sabine National Forest and the scenic Toledo Bend Reservoir. With a low population density of 21 people per square mile, Sabine provides ample opportunities for those seeking secluded acreage or recreational properties. The county's terrain features a mix of forested areas and water bodies, ideal for nature enthusiasts and outdoor recreation. Major highways like U.S. 96 ensure good accessibility, while the presence of national forests indicates high ecological value. Economically, Sabine County's median home price of $131,900 is significantly lower than the national average, making land acquisition potentially more affordable. However, prospective buyers should note the county's higher unemployment rate of 6.9% and lower labor force participation of 44.8% compared to national averages.
